Learning from the Worst: Dynamically Generated Datasets to Improve Online Hate Detection
Bertie Vidgen, Tristan Thrush, Zeerak Waseem, Douwe Kiela

TL;DR
This paper introduces a dynamic, human-in-the-loop dataset creation process that significantly improves online hate detection models by providing challenging, well-labeled data and demonstrating enhanced robustness and accuracy.
Contribution
The paper presents a novel dynamic data generation method with multiple rounds of annotation, resulting in a large, challenging dataset that enhances hate detection model performance.
Findings
Models trained on later data rounds perform better on test sets.
The approach increases model robustness against adversarial examples.
The dataset includes detailed labels for hate type and target.
Abstract
We present a human-and-model-in-the-loop process for dynamically generating datasets and training better performing and more robust hate detection models. We provide a new dataset of ~40,000 entries, generated and labelled by trained annotators over four rounds of dynamic data creation. It includes ~15,000 challenging perturbations and each hateful entry has fine-grained labels for the type and target of hate. Hateful entries make up 54% of the dataset, which is substantially higher than comparable datasets. We show that model performance is substantially improved using this approach. Models trained on later rounds of data collection perform better on test sets and are harder for annotators to trick. They also perform better on HateCheck, a suite of functional tests for online hate detection. We provide the code, dataset and annotation guidelines for other researchers to use. Accepted…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Code & Models
- 🤗HannahRoseKirk/Hatemojimodel· 10 dl· ♡ 410 dl♡ 4
- 🤗facebook/roberta-hate-speech-dynabench-r1-targetmodel· 8 dl· ♡ 18 dl♡ 1
- 🤗facebook/roberta-hate-speech-dynabench-r2-targetmodel· 5 dl5 dl
- 🤗facebook/roberta-hate-speech-dynabench-r3-targetmodel· 3 dl3 dl
- 🤗facebook/roberta-hate-speech-dynabench-r4-targetmodel· 909k dl· ♡ 98909k dl♡ 98
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
